Hurmur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Hurmur Village has a population of 659 (659) with 321 (321) males and 338 (338) females.The sex ratio in Hurmur is 1053,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Hurmur Village is 148 (148) which is 22.46% of Hurmur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Hurmur Village is 1115 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Hurmur village is listed as part of the Satbarwa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Palamu District in the state of JHARKHAND in INDIA.
The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Hurmur Literacy Rate
Hurmur Village has a literacy rate of 43.64%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Hurmur Village is 49.4 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Hurmur Village is 38.08 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Hurmur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Hurmur Village is 360 (360) with 174 (174) males and 186 (186) females, which is 54.63% of Hurmur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1069 females for every 1000 males.
Hurmur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Hurmur Village is 214 (214) with 105 (105) males and 109 (109) females, which is 32.47% of Hurmur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1039 females for every 1000 males.

Hurmur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Hurmur Village, there are about 307 (307) workers, making up nearly 46.59% of the Hurmur Village total population. Out of these, around 157 (157) are male workers, and about 150 (150) are female workers.
